Persistent Systems announced that they have partnered with
IL&FS Education and Technology Services to develop a series of
mobile-based learning applications on IL&FS Education's
learning platform, Exploriments.
Exploriment is a simulation-based interactive learning platform
designed for enhancing students’ conceptual understanding in
science and mathematics. As a technology partner, Persistent
Systems will be developing mobile-based applications on the
Exploriments learning model for various mobile platforms like
tablets and other handheld devices.

Exploriments, doesn’t intend to transfer traditional
classroom teaching to digital pedagogy or convert print materials
into a digital format. But it endeavors to create a platform that
enhances the delivery of quality education through the use of
technology by providing a highly interactive, exploratory, and
engaging experience for students and teachers. Rushikesh Bandekar,

Exploriments, designed primarily for tablets such as iPads, will
also be compatible with various other devices such as handheld PCs
and netbooks. Leveraging the Android and iOS Centers of Excellence
(CoE), Persistent Systems will help build many such Exploriments
that work on multiple devices of different form factors.
